All residents of the United Kingdom must apply for a National
Insurance number.
This number is similar to a:

Tax File number in Australia

The IRD number in New Zealand
The Social Insurance number in Canada
The Social Security number in the USA and the
Identification number in South Africa.

It is used as a unique reference/account number by the Inland Revenue, and by medical
practitioners when you are seeking any form of medical attention.
